A RESOLUTION
No._____
WHEREAS, the State has discussed closing the Western Regional Crime Lab located
in Columbus within Fiscal Year 2010 due to a budget shortfall of $66,525.00
dollars;
WHEREAS, all 19 counties served by the Crime Lab are being asked to participate
in raising $66,525.00 dollars;
WHEREAS, a local Crime Lab is essential for the public safety and well being of
the citizens of Columbus and this Council desires the Crime Lab to remain open
through the end of Fiscal Year 2010;
NOW, THEREFORE, THE COUNCIL OF COLUMBUS, GEORGIA HEREBY RESOLVES:
We hereby authorize the Mayor, City Manager and Finance Director to enter into
an agreement with the Georgia Bureau of Investigation for the specific purpose
of keeping open the Western Regional Crime Lab and to expend up to $66,525.00
for the purpose of funding the Western Regional Crime Lab for Fiscal Year 2010.
______________
Introduced at a regular meeting of the Council of Columbus, Georgia held on the
23rd day of March, 2010, and adopted at said meeting by the affirmative vote of
______ members of Council.
